This is one of the great romantic era Imperial German Army Revolvers, and this is a rare Navy Issued example. The M1879 Reichsrevolver, or Reichs Commissions Revolver Modell 1879, was a service revolver used by the German Army from 1879 to 1908, when it was superseded by the Luger.
